Corinna Vinschen wrote: > > This is similar to the -X option in httpd but that option let httpd > running in single process mode. That's more like the -d option in > sshd which is only useful for debugging purposes, either. yep. > If you could patch httpd to get a new option which differs from the > usual run mode only by not forking and detaching the master process, > we could start it using cygrunsrv as well. That shouldn't be too > hard. The -D option in sshd is really just skipping a function call > `daemon()'. ok, I'll put my hands on it.
